Official – Inter Milan Sign Croatia International Midfielder Petar Sucic From Dinamo Zagreb

Inter Milan have completed the signing of Croatian international midfielder Petar Sucic from Dinamo Zagreb. The Nerazzurri officially announce the 22-year-old's arrival. He will be available for the Nerazzurri squad starting with the FIFA Club World Cup this summer. Advertisement Inter have decided to make midfielder Petar Sucic their latest signing in midfield. Sucic has reportedly signed a 5 year contract with Inter. The Croat plays in the holding midfield position. Therefore, the Nerazzurri are signing Sucic as a potential long-term heir to Hakan Calhanoglu at the base of midfield. Despite being just 22 years of age, Sucic has proven adept at playing the tactically demanding position. Inter do not announce the fee that they've paid to Dinamo for Sucic. But reports indicate that they have paid an initial €14 million, with another €2.5 million or so in add-ons. Inter Milan Sign Petar Sucic From Dinamo Zagreb SALZBURG, AUSTRIA – OCTOBER 23: Petar Sucic of GNK Dinamo is challenged by Samson Baidoo of FC Salzburg during the UEFA Champions League 2024/25 League Phase MD3 match between FC Salzburg and GNK Dinamo at Stadion Salzburg on October 23, 2024 in Salzburg, Austria. (Photo by). Petar Sucic is the younger cousin of current Real Sociedad midfielder Luka Sucic. Advertisement The 22-year-old is a full Croatian international. He won his first cap for the senior national team last autumn, and has made a total of five appearances. Meanwhile, Sucic has made sixty appearances for Dinamo. He has scored five goals for the Croatian giants. Sucic will stay at Dinamo for the remainder of the current season. Then, at the end of the campaign the Croat will link up with the Inter squad. Sucic will be available for the Club World Cup this summer. Then, he will be part of the squad for next season. Sucic has played two seasons at Dinamo Zagreb. During that time he has featured 75 times across all competitions, scoring nine times in the process. To date, Sucic has featured seven times for Croatia, scoring once.

The Walking Dead: Dead City – Season 2 Episode 5 'The Bird Always Knows' Recap & Review

Episode 5 Episode 5 of The Walking Dead: Dead City Season 2 begins with the Croat trying on a fancy suit when some men cut the lights in one of the avenues. Perlie, Maggie and Hershel are making their way back to the park and worry about how to steal the methane supply with their dwindling numbers. Maggie recognises the Dama from Hershel's drawing and asks him. He deflects by asking about her conversation with Negan. Well, Negan is busy watching Dama fawn over her pet rat. She lashes out at Croat for the blackout and takes him out of the Christos meeting. She even mocks his new outfit and he sulks. Back in the park, Lucia has arrested the forager leader, Roksana, for not supporting their cause. She has Ginny oversee Perlie and Maggie's arrest for lying about Negan. Ginny complies as she is upset that Maggie didn't tell her about Negan. Lucia holds Hershel hostage as she has a job for Maggie. Maggie is to lead Negan and Croat into an ambush of the park walkers while the New Babylonians steal the methane. Perlie is locked up with Roksana and he begs her to join Lucia. He points out that she is replaceable but Roksana stands strong in her defiance. Meanwhile, Negan brings methane canisters as gifts for Christos who vehemently refuses to join the alliance. Negans spots several kids and finds common ground in what it is like to have one's family in danger. Christos is surprised but agrees to hear him out. Unfortunately, Croat barges in, having found Christos' knife near the cut wires. Christos tries to defend himself but he passes out. Turns out the methane canisters were open. The Burazi kill all the men in Christos' gang. Croat points out that he has left the women and children alive but Negan is upset. Next, Maggie sneaks back into the park and tries to rescue Perlie and Roksana. When he disapproves of her strategy of going against Lucia, she locks him back in. She finds Lucia sitting with Hershel. The officer wonders if Negan and Maggie are exes since they are so obsessed with each other. Hershel is disturbed but spots Maggie and plays along. Maggie one-ups Lucia but Ginny pops up and points a gun at Hershel. Maggie is forced to back down and Lucia arrests her. Perlie is upset and wishes he had stopped Maggie. Roksana tells him about the Road Not Taken story and adds a twist, that it's okay to have some help when venturing onto a new path. At the theatre, Negan sows discord by pointing out to the Croat that the Dama treats her rat better than him. Negan even covers for him but the Dama still blames the Croat for losing Christos' gang. He rambles his defence but Dama simply considers it a kid's tantrum. Negan looks smug. That night, the public executions of Roksana, Maggie and Perlie begin. Lucia is cruel as she hangs Roksana mid-speech. The foragers' cry attracts the park walkers. They let themselves be taken and Lucia starts killing them to shut them up. Ginny is bothered and helps Perlie escape. Maggie almost hangs but she escapes and goes after Lucia who has Hershel. But Walker Roksana kills Lucia. Maggie and Hershel make it back in and regroup with Ginny and Perlie. Ginny had been impaled by a branch but she keeps her wound hidden. Maggie asks Hershel about the Dama again and he reveals that she understood him. But he never wanted to hurt anyone and regrets the ferry deaths. They are interrupted by Bruegel and his men. It cuts to the rat being crushed to death. The Dama suspects the Croat and lashes out at him, she claims he is nothing without her. He has had enough and points out that the methane is all him. She is a queen with no real power. She bites him and in the scuffle, the chandelier falls on her. He tries to help but stops himself and runs off as she burns. At the end of The Walking Dead: Dead City Season 2 Episode 5, we see that it is Negan who killed the rat. The Episode Review The one flaw with The Walking Dead spin-offs starring the original cast is that they don't invest in ensembles. Not like the parent show or Fear The Walking Dead. It is very clear that the main leads are the original characters like Daryl and Carol, Rick and Michonne, Maggie and Negan. This means there is no actual danger to them, heavy plot armour and expected plot twists that will save our heroes right on time. Three of the supposed bad guys in Dead City Season 2 are killed before they can do any real damage. Governor Byrd doesn't even get her own death scene. And sure, we are not watching these spin-offs for the danger and excitement TWD used to provide, killing off main characters right in the middle of the season. Remember T-Dog? Yeah, good times. These spin-offs are mostly fan service and a quick cash grab. So, give us the fan service and drama. The TWD writers have three strengths that make their scripts stand out – community politics, creative walker action and character dynamics. Instead of putting Maggie constantly on the verge of death, this chapter literally hangs her for a second but we know she is in no danger, give us some more complex Maggie and Negan interactions. Elaborate on Hershel and Dama's weird relationship. Expand the New Babylon threat to Manhattan. TWDverse has a successful formula and the writers should rely on it. Sky: Lazio make offer for Sarri's return

Sky Sport Italia reports that Lazio want Maurizio Sarri's return and have offered their former coach a €2.8m-a-year deal until 2027. Lazio are pushing for Sarri's return to their bench and have already made an offer to their former boss, according to Sky Sport Italia. Advertisement The Tuscan tactician resigned as Lazio's coach in March 2024 and has been without a club since. How much have Lazio offered for Sarri's return? MUNICH, GERMANY – MARCH 04: SS Lazio head coach Maurizio Sarri attends during the press conference at the Allianz Arena on March 04, 2024 in Munich, Germany. (Photo by Marco Rosi –) Sarri, a 2020 Serie A winner with Juventus, later explained he had left Lazio last year mostly for personal reasons. According to Sky Sport Italia, Lazio have now offered Sarri a €2.8m-a-year contract until 2027. The Italian broadcasters claim that talks between the two parties are 'ongoing' with Lazio pushing to finalise the deal. Lazio replaced Sarri with Igor Tudor last season, but the Croat didn't remain at the helm for the 2024-25 campaign, prompting the Biancocelesti to hire Marco Baroni. Advertisement The latter collected excellent results in the first part of the season, but was ultimately eliminated from the Europa League quarter-finals and finished the Serie A campaign outside a European placement. Baroni is under contract until 2026, but the Biancocelesti are expected to terminate the agreement with their coach in the coming days.

Luka Modric pitched Rangers move by Davide Ancelotti and Real Madrid legend 'didn't say no'

A bombshell report claims Ancelotti has already pitched Modric on a potential move to Ibrox – and that he didn't say no Rangers' next boss frontrunner Davide Ancelotti has reportedly asked Luka Modric if he would join him at Ibrox. It comes with the Scottish Premiership club now facing a race against the clock to appoint the Italian - who is said to be being chased by three other "high level" clubs thus summer. ‌ Carlo Ancelotti revealed that his son is in talks with multiple clubs over taking the top job in the dugout - and not just Rangers - with RB Leipzig thought to be a potential destination. ‌ Writing for the BBC, Spanish football expert Guillem Balague has claimed that Ancelotti Jr held talks with Ibrox chiefs in London last week with further discussions to follow in the coming days. Record Sport revealed US tycoon Andrew Cavenagh - who is spearheading the San Francisco 49ers-backed takeover - is set to meet Ancelotti and Russell Martin face-to-face in the coming days as the search for a new boss reached an end. It is claimed Ancelotti believes he is the club's first choice, and "a resolution could be reached in the coming days." ‌ Balague notes that if a decision isn't reached by the end of this week or by the first week of June at the latest the club "risk missing out on Ancelotti" with other clubs showing interest. It is claimed that Ancelotti Jr told the Real Madrid superstars - including Modric - about the prospect of becoming the next Rangers manager before he left the Bernabeu at the end of last season. Reportedly Ancelotti asked the Croat - who is now out of contract - if "he'd fancy coming to Rangers and he didn't say no." Where Can I Watch The Walking Dead: Dead City Season 2? The Walking Dead: Dead City Season 2 will be airing on AMC and AMC+ at the moment. It is available to stream on Hulu and Amazon Prime as well as they have a tie-up with AMC+. The other shows of the TWD universe are available on AMC, Disney+, Amazon Prime and Netflix in selected territories. The Walking Dead: Dead City Season 2 Episode 5 Release Date The Walking Dead: Dead City Season 2 Episode 5 will release on Sunday 1st June at approximately 9pm (ET) / 2am (GMT) the next day. AMC is known to release English subtitles immediately. Season 2 Episode 5 is titled 'The Bird Always Knows'. Expect each episode to be roughly 1 hour long, which is consistent with the time frame for the rest of TWD shows. How Many Episodes Will The Walking Dead: Dead City Season 2 Have? The Walking Dead: Dead City Season 2 is an 8-episode English-language show. It will release one episode every Sunday and run its course till 22nd June.
